THE 'CRUISER TOYOTA SHOULD HAVE BUILT

SOMETIMES, it takes a setback to take a step forward in life. And unfortunately for the owner of this 105 Series LandCruiser, Callum Mackellar, it took a serious accident for him to arrive at this dream setup. Callum cut his teeth in the 4WDing world in a 2003 Holden Jackaroo, and a slow, yet trusty 105 Series LandCruiser with the naturally aspirated 1HZ diesel motor which he loved to pieces. Sadly, that vehicle is no longer with us.

“My first 105 was written off,” says Callum. “But that presented me with the opportunity to buy the holy grail, a stock-as-a-rock 2003 Kakadu Grey 105 LandCruiser. Well, stock apart from having a Saharaspec interior trim conversion, and (let’s be honest – the main attraction) a highly sought-after factory turbo-diesel 1HD-FTE motor swapped in.”

The 4.2-litre 1HD-FTE factory turbodiesel motor needs no introduction, as it’s proven to be an absolute workhorse; yet it was only available in the 100 Series LandCruiser which features a torsion bar IFS setup that isn’t favoured by hardcore 4WDers. When Callum saw this beast up for sale, with the factory turbo motor swapped into a 105 Series Cruiser with solid axles front-and-rear, he knew it was too special to pass up on.
